WARRINGTON Town are through to the third qualifying round of the FA Cup.

Mark Roberts' winner 20 minutes from time secured victory at FC United of Manchester.

Mitch Duggan's wonder strike had earlier cancelled out Regan Linney's opener for the Red Rebels at Broadhurst Park.

Yellows will now await the third qualifying round draw on Monday.

Match facts:

FA Cup, second qualifying round

Saturday, September 21, 2019

FC United of Manchester...1 Warrington Town...2

FC United: Wharton, Morris, Dodd, Doyle, Dean, Jones, Rodney, Potts (Lenehan), Owolabi, Linney (Sharp), Carney (Donohue). Subs not used: Hellawell, Blackledge, Joyce, Belford

Goalscorers: Linney (26, pen)

Bookings: N/A

Warrington Town: McMillan, Duggan, Barnes, Jennings, Roberts, Raven, Garrity, Sephton, Chadwick (Dunn (Dixon)), Gray, Byrne (Amis). Subs not used: McCarten, Warren, Tansey, Speare

Goalscorers: Duggan (29), Roberts (70)

Bookings: Jennings, Amis, Duggan

Attendance: 1,263
